iPhone and Android Will Dominate Phone Cell-Market in 2015

July 28, 2010 by Jingga · 3 Comments
Filed under: Tech News 

Ovum research firm projected that the total amount of the downloadable mobile application in the Asia Pacific region will reach 5.3 billion later in 2015 later. The majority came from the Apple iPhone and mobile users Google Android. From these approximate figures, a total of 597.15 million applications, or approximately 11% of them will be controlled by the iPhone. The total downloaded apps will only be rivaled by other mobile users that use the Android operating systems.

“Apple iPhone will dominate the smartphone market segment of high end within the next five years. However, this dominance will remain under strong competition from Android-based handsets,” said Ovum analyst Adam Leach, as quoted from the AFP on Wednesday .

According to Leach, the presence of Google Android started two years ago have become a new phenomenon and allow every handset maker creates an interesting alternative to the iPhone. In fact, Leach said, a handset that uses Android platform looks like iPhone clone. “Android-based device offers a wider freedom with the available content . And perhaps more interesting than the device with content that is only approved by Apple alone,” he added.
